THE/IHE & PebblePad Webinar: Embedding Real-World Learning into Curriculum

 

Webinar details

In this engaging on-demand webinar, leaders from the University of Georgia, Michigan Technological University, and PebblePad share how institutions are addressing the need to prepare students to succeed in today’s workplace. 

Colleges and universities must reimagine traditional curriculum models to meet job market demands and develop student competencies. But how? Success stories from universities that embed experiential learning in their programs reveal how the approach can be leveraged to address learner skills gaps. 

What you’ll learn:

Held in partnership with Times Higher Education/Inside Higher Ed, the webinar features how institutions:

  • Map learning experiences to in-demand skills and workforce needs
  • Apply strategies for integrating real-world and practical experiences into course design
  • Facilitate experiential learning with institution-wide collaboration
  • Establish a rubric to track student experiences and milestones throughout their journey
  • Align experiential learning with lifelong learning to increase access and support diverse cohorts
